What mediates the attractive force that allows electrons to form Cooper pairs despite their natural repulsion?

Answer

Interaction with the crystal lattice via lattice vibrations (phonons).

The attraction is mediated by the crystal lattice; an electron slightly deforms the lattice, creating a region of positive charge that then attracts a second electron, binding them via phonons.
